article

Softwareentwicklung

Text auf dem Desktop mittels Cut&Paste ablegen – das gehört selbst bei Kommandozeilen-Liebhabern zum Standardrepertoire. Dabei unterstützt der Windowmanager auf dem Linux-Desktop zwei Puffermechanismen: die primäre Selektion und das Clipboard [2]. Wer mit der Maus Text markiert, lässt den...

Editorial

Das Jahr 2011 war für Linux kein schlechtes, das runde zwanzigste war es zudem. Weder musste jemand einen Rettungssschirm spannen, noch kam es über Plagiatsvorwürfe ins Straucheln. Auch gab es keine Kernschmelze im Open-Source-Reaktor. Man muss schon suchen, um ein kleines Drama zu finden: Ein...

Titelthema

Jetzt steht es im Licht der Öffentlichkeit: Android 4.0, Googles Smartphone- und Tablet-Betriebssystem mit dem drolligen Maskottchen, aussichtsreicher iPhone-Herausforderer und Hoffnungsträger aller Gerätehersteller (außer Nokia). Der Schwerpunkt porträtiert das...

Netz & System

Charly ist seit genau zehn Jahren Autor dieser Kolumne. Für seine Jubiläumsausgabe legt er sich einen empfindlichen Detektor zurecht, der die kosmische Hintergrundstrahlung des Internets misst: Portscans.

Softwareentwicklung

Gtkdialog 0.8.0 GUIs für eigene Skripte basteln Quelle: http://code.google.com/p/gtkdialog Lizenz: GPLv2 Alternativen: Zenity, Xdialog Eigene Programme mit grafischen Oberflächen auszustatten ist dank Gtkdialog äußerst komfortabel. Das Werkzeug erlaubt es, das GUI in einer einfachen...

Hardware

Programmierbare Logikbausteine haben das Entwerfen digitaler Schaltungen dramatisch vereinfacht. Noch ohne Lötkolben können Profis und Hobbybastler ihr Werk gemeinsam mit der darauf laufenden Software testen. Hardwarebeschreibungs-Sprachen, freie Tools und Erweiterungen machen die...

Szene

Provider sitzen in der Zwickmühle: Sie hosten Webseiten für zahlende Kunden. Tauchen dort aber ehrenrührige Inhalte auf, drohen deftige Schadensersatzforderungen. Die Frage, auf wessen Seite Provider sich besser stellen sollten, regelt der deutsche Bundesgerichtshof nun in einem Urteil.

Editorial

Nachdem der Chaos Computer Club einen Trojaner vom Laptop eines Bodybuilders gekratzt hat, auf den vor Jahren bayerische LKA-Ermittler ein Auge geworfen hatten, werden weitere Details der Überwachungspraxis bekannt. Die schon etwas veraltete CCC-Version der Bayern-Backdoor läuft nur auf PCs...

Softwareentwicklung

Lambda-Funktionen sind die praktischen Helfer der Sprache C++11. Schon nach kurzer Zeit möchte kein C++-Entwickler sie missen, denn mit ihnen ist ein Algorithmus rasch und ohne Umschweife formuliert. Außerdem darf er sie wie Objekte behandeln.

Szene

Haben Sie Anregungen, Statements oder Kommentare? Dann schreiben Sie an redaktion@linux-magazin.de. Die Redaktion behält es sich vor, die Zuschriften und Leserbriefe zu kürzen. Sie veröffentlicht alle Beiträge mit Namen, sofern der Autor nicht ausdrücklich...

Softwareentwicklung

CSV-DB CSV-Dateien mit SQL-Statements bearbeiten Quelle: http://sandbox.ltmnet.com/csvdb Lizenz: GPLv3 Alternativen: MySQL CSV DB ist eineDatenbank-Engine, die das Verwalten von CSV-Dateien mit SQL-Befehlen ermöglicht. Dazu stehen die DML-Kommandos »select« , »update« , »insert« und...

Titelthema

Android 4.0 erweitert die Möglichkeiten des App-Entwicklers bedeutend. Dank neuer Programmierschnittstellen kann er seine Anwendungen mit dem Kalender verknüpfen oder per Wi-Fi Direct drahtlosen Kontakt zu anderen Android-Geräten in der Umgebung aufnehmen.

Nach oben